Then there’s Jumeirah Mosque, one of the few mosques in the UAE open to non-Muslim visitors for guided tours. Also known as a cultural classroom for families, it teaches kids about Islamic art, architecture, and traditions in a way that’s respectful, simple, and engaging. And if you want to combine fun with learning, Dubai Museum of the Future, an interactive space where kids solve puzzles, touch holograms, and imagine life in 2071. Also known as a hands-on science playground, it turns curiosity into discovery without a single worksheet in sight.
